Grey launches digital command centre
An advertising agency has set up a digital command centre that it says will provide a real-time marketing capability for its clients.
Grey Digital, until recently known as Yolk, has set up the unit in Malaysia and plans to roll out the capability across the region.
Known as Real Time Marketing Command Cente, or REALM, the facility will generate insights from social media and online media performance results, which will be used to tweak campaigns in real time.
Clients Resorts World Genting and Maybank have signed up to use the service, which uses a proprietary tool to analyse data from a number of different sources.
Benjamin Tan, CEO of Grey Digital Southeast Asia, said: “With this capability, clients will no longer have to rely on insights based on a single end-user report. Instead clients can tap into this managed service and achieve real-time advantage.”
The news emerges not long after clients MasterCard and Philips announced the launch of their own inhouse digital command centres.
